技术文摘
如何在mysql中导出数据库数据
如何在MySQL中导出数据库数据
在MySQL数据库管理中,导出数据是一项常见且重要的操作。无论是为了数据备份、迁移到其他系统,还是进行数据共享,掌握正确的数据导出方法都至关重要。下面将详细介绍几种在MySQL中导出数据库数据的常见方式。
使用命令行工具(MySQLDump)
MySQLDump是MySQL自带的命令行工具,用于备份数据库或特定表的数据和结构。它功能强大,操作简便。
打开命令行终端,确保已正确配置MySQL环境变量。如果要导出整个数据库,命令格式为:mysqldump -u [用户名] -p [数据库名] > [备份文件名].sql。例如,用户名是root,数据库名为test,备份文件名为test_backup.sql,那么在命令行中输入mysqldump -u root -p test > test_backup.sql,回车后输入密码即可开始备份。
若只想导出特定的表,命令为:mysqldump -u [用户名] -p [数据库名] [表1] [表2] > [备份文件名].sql。这种方式适合只需要部分数据的情况。
通过图形化工具(如phpMyAdmin)
对于不太熟悉命令行操作的用户,图形化工具更为直观方便。phpMyAdmin是一款广泛使用的MySQL管理工具。
登录phpMyAdmin后,在左侧选择要导出的数据库。然后点击上方的“导出”选项卡。在导出页面,可以选择“快速”或“自定义”模式。快速模式会导出整个数据库结构和数据;自定义模式则允许更精细的设置,如选择特定的表、设置导出格式(SQL、CSV等)。设置完成后,点击“执行”按钮,即可下载备份文件。
使用MySQL Workbench
MySQL Workbench是MySQL官方的可视化数据库设计和管理工具。
打开MySQL Workbench并连接到目标数据库。在菜单栏中选择“服务器”,然后点击“数据导出”。在弹出的窗口中,可选择要导出的数据库或表。还能设置导出选项,如是否包含创建表语句、数据等。设置好后,指定输出文件名和路径,点击“开始导出”即可完成操作。
不同的导出方式适用于不同的场景,用户可根据自身需求灵活选择。熟练掌握这些方法,能确保MySQL数据库数据的安全备份与有效迁移。
TAGS: 数据库数据导出 数据导出技巧 MySQL数据库导出 mysql导出操作
- 遗留代码升级的卓越实践
- 中国博士打造可交互全球疫情地图 登柳叶刀 GitHub获 4500 星
- JavaScript 工具函数全览
- 深入解析 Javascript 函数中的递归思想:案例与代码
- 前端性能优化的内容与方法
- Python 数据建模指南:数据到模型的实现路径与炼丹师经验分享
- Python 命令行查全国 7 天天气的实现
- 12 个令人惊叹的 Pandas 与 NumPy 函数
- Java 堆内存是否为线程共享?面试官质疑
- 浅析 Java 虚拟机内存区域
- 微信小程序自动化怎么做之探讨
- 在浏览器中实现 JavaScript 计时器的 4 种新颖方法
- volatile 与 synchronized 的差异:多图文详细解析
- 调研 10 家公司技术架构,我得出大数据平台的一套套路
- 2020 年 Vue 会比 React 更受欢迎吗?